MinTTY is a terminal emulator for Cygwin with a native Windows user
interface and minimalist design. Its terminal emulation is largely
compatible with xterm, but it does not require an X server to be
running. It is based on code from PuTTY 0.60 by Simon Tatham and team.

This is a compatibility update.

CHANGES (since 0.3.6-1)
=======================
- The Home and End keys now send "PC-style" ^[[H and ^[[F instead of
VT220-style ^[[1~ and ~[[4~. This is for compatibility with xterm's
default configuration and the xterm termcap/terminfo entries, which
means that Home and End should work out-of-the box now in bash, i.e.
configuring them in ~/.inputrc is no longer necessary.
- The Reset menu command and the ^[c ('Full Reset') control sequence
now clear the scrollback as well as the screen.
- The manual page has gained a tip on using 'sh -c' for setting
environment variables in mintty shortcuts.
